Shelly Leeke Law Firm, with offices throughout South Carolina, provides dedicated legal representation for truck accident victims in Columbia. With over 10 years of experience, their attorneys understand the catastrophic injuries and financial burdens that can result from collisions with tractor-trailers. The firm emphasizes the importance of understanding South Carolina’s modified comparative negligence law, which reduces compensation based on the victim’s percentage of fault and bars recovery if their blame exceeds 51%. As a fault state for auto accidents, victims typically file claims with the liable party’s insurance, though settlements may be limited by policy coverage. The statute of limitations for personal injury lawsuits in South Carolina is 3 years. Their attorneys thoroughly investigate accidents to determine liability, which may include the truck driver, trucking company, cargo loaders, government agencies, maintenance technicians, or manufacturers. They help victims recover both economic damages (medical expenses, lost wages) and non-economic damages (pain and suffering, emotional trauma), and potentially punitive damages in cases of gross negligence.
